Patrick Ellard | 25 comments Three quarters of this book are excellent. I liked the folk horror setting, it's creepy at times and the central mystery is gripping right up until the point that it isn't. The final few chapters seem rushed and the pay off is a little disappointing. It's not enough to ruin the book but it's definitely a shame.
